Podcast - Game Level Learn

by Jonathan Cassie

Game Level Learn is a podcast exploring connections between games, gaming and gamification and education.

An Introduction to Using Roleplaying Games In Game-Based Learning and Gamification

1h 4m · Published 05 Jul 18:10

One of the greatest books on the history of the tabletop roleplaying hobby is by Jon Peterson. It is called Playing At The World. 

Empire of Imagination is a biography of one of Dungeons&Dragons' founders, Gary Gygax.

 

The basic rules set to Dungeons & Dragons that Jon mentioned in the episode.

The Call of Cthulhu roleplaying game Tracy's been getting into of late. One of the great classics.

One of my enduring classics - Rolemaster.

The World of Darkness setting for those into contemporary supernatural/monster stories.

Jon's favorite RPG these days is Numenera. It's character creation system will be discussed in episodes to come.

We discussed our great experience playing Hillfolk, which you can check out at the link.

 

 

Play These Roleplaying Games (season 2.8)

0s · Published 21 Dec 23:45

Jon recommends the following three roleplaying games (RPGs): HARP, The Quiet Year and Numenera.

If you'd like to support this work, here are links to my two books for HARP: HARP Loot (about, well, loot), and HARP Folkways, about building meaningful, realistic cultures for game settings.

Tracy recommends these great games: Fiasco, Dread and Dungeons&Dragons, 5th edition.

Your HOMEWORK!

Find a Con or a Meetup near you and visit. Play some games from earlier in the season or just explore and learn.

Create a character in some RPG system, or create yourself in the unforgivingly honest Time Lords.

Play a game solo, like Arkham Horror: The Card Game.

Listen to some podcasts, like How We Roll or Godsfall.

Read a book about games and gaming, like Greg Toppo's "The Game Believes In You," (the actual title...not the one I made up from whole cloth in the episode..., Jane McGonigal's "Reality Is Broken," Aaron Dignan's "Game Frame,"  "Second Person," or my own offering "Level Up Your Classroom."
